当前位置: 首页 >
nodejs 真的不擅长CPU密集型计算么,与c++或者 rust 差别有多大?_河北省邯郸市馆陶县居住可可有限责任公司
- 6 月 18 日苏炳添跑出 11 秒 37 未能进入决赛,这是否意味着职业生涯已经进入新阶段?
- 最适合个人使用的Linux桌面发行版是哪个?
- 你身边身材最好的女生是什么样?
- 如何看待「苏超」赞助商1个月增加超200%,达到中超2倍?
- 穿瑜伽裤爬山的女生会不会害羞?
- 为什么感觉腾讯的风评越来越好了?
- 伊朗称击落两架以 F-35 战机并公布战机残骸照片,称俘获一名飞行员,具体情况如何?该战机战力如何?
- 有什么是你去了上海才知道的事情?
- AE如何渲染出mp4格式?
- 你见过身边身材最好的女生是什么样子的?
联系我们
邮箱:
手机:
电话:
地址:
nodejs 真的不擅长CPU密集型计算么,与c++或者 rust 差别有多大?
作者: 发布时间:2025-06-27 22:55:17点击:
首先要明白 Node.js 不适合 CPU 密集型的本质,是没有一个简单的方法把计算过程也多线程化。
Node.js 中 IO 任务是天然多线程的,也就是所谓的异步非阻塞 IO,所以效率很高,当你开启一个 IO 任务的时候,程序可以继续做其他事。
但如果你要做的是一个又臭又长的计算任务,那自始至终都只有一个线程。
这就很炸裂了。
Node.js里也存在 Worker Threads、Cluster之类的方法可以让你手动迁移计算任务,但都不是很方便,以及开销过大…。
新闻资讯
-
2025-06-20北京日报点名批评“苏超”过度娱乐化,它是否管的太宽了?为什么无良媒体不会被查封取缔?
-
2025-06-20一米二的棍子打的赢三十厘米的刀子吗?
-
2025-06-20据说go和c#的开发者都说自己比较节省内存,你们认为呢?
-
2025-06-20北京日报点名批评“苏超”过度娱乐化的动机是什么?
-
2025-06-20以色列为什么突然敢打伊朗了?不怕被报复?
-
2025-06-20国产轮胎那么便宜,为什么很多人非要买高价的国外轮胎??
相关产品